The load that comes from inside
Every action in this collection has been applied from outside — a weight, a pressure, a movement, a temperature. Corrosion is not applied at all, and the reason it belongs to statics rather than to durability is that what does the damage is a load: rust occupies three times the volume of the steel it came from, and the only place to make room is by pushing the cover apart.
